Cheapest Available New Holstein and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of July 23,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in New Holstein, WI is the 2 Bedroom Model starting from $895 at Village Apartments . The second most affordable New Holstein 2 Bedroom is the 2 Bed 1 Bath Model at Birchwood Apartments starting at $949 in the Suburban Fond du Lac ne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in New Holstein is currently $1,534.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in New Holstein:

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
